Linking advanced tracking technology with global humanitarian relief
Implementation of tracking technology speeds distribution time, provides verifiable receipt of vital provisions ensuring equitable distribution, and minimizes theft. This also helps to provide full visibility into the supply chain journey of urgently needed items through the critical ‘last mile’ of delivery to refugees, where human tracking and data input errors often lead to inconsistent delivery and distribution.
UPS Relief Link aims to help improve the lives of displaced refugees around the world. The program does this through optimized distribution and tracking of critical supplies in crisis-affected areas. It combines the use of a hand-held scanning tool and durable identification cards to deliver superior efficiency by eliminating paper records in the refugee camps.
